Abstract

The paper analyses the current challenges and updates readership with contemporary happenings of this world. Noam Chomsky assesses the foreseen dangers before human race in the 21st century. As the entire mankind is moving on the way of democratic system and freedom around the world, Professor Chomsky makes his readers to realize a sense of responsibility towards the humanity. He bluntly attacks over the US policies at large which are making pseudo promises of freedom and democracy for all. He establishes that the US due to its hegemonic existence is intentionally fighting against the democratic progressive movements in order to push its capitalist's interests.
